@Brad Sage Several things.
4:38 PM
First, it is best practice to approach the possibility of making a tulpa as irreversable - as for all practical intents and purposes, it is.
4:39 PM
Once a tulpa is sufficiently developed, to the point where they can interact with you of their own volition (in other words, not strongly dependent on your attention and to the point that is fairly unambiguously 'independent' as far as a tulpa can be), it is extremely difficult to dissipate them.
4:40 PM
"Stasis" is possible by ignoring them, certainly - as is eventual dissipation if they don't essentially cling to being active. However, ignoring them until they go away is not something that you should really view as an option when going into it.
4:41 PM
In other words, don't treat a tulpa as disposable or making one as a reversable process - treat it as the serious decision that it is and take your time before making a final decision.
4:42 PM
You have a very very long time (relatively speaking) to choose to make a tulpa, and a very long time to make that tulpa if you do choose to make one.
4:43 PM
Second - form is imaginary. It is solely there as a means of symbolism, a different way to contextualize communication. Let them choose their own if they can, certainly - but it isn't too important.
4:44 PM
Third - trying to impose is associated with tulpas but ultimately not intrinsically related, as it is simply learning to experience controlled hallucinations. ...most people use them to interact with their tulpas, hence why it is associated with them - but controlled hallucinations are by no means exclusive to tulpas if you choose to work on developing them.
4:45 PM
Fourth... treat your tulpa with all the respect, consideration, and kindess that you would afford another person - right from the outset. While some have said things can go wrong as a result, I haven't personally seen such happening.
4:45 PM
So - don't be hugely concerned there, unless you plan on being directly abusive.
4:46 PM
...in which case, don't make a tulpa.
